In an era marked by rapid change, uncertainty, and unprecedented challenges, the world is yearning for visionary leaders who can inspire progress and drive meaningful transformation. Leaders are no longer measured solely by their ability to deliver results; they are judged by their capacity to envision a better future, unite people under a shared purpose, and create lasting impact.


photo image of Fahd Khater

The modern landscape demands leaders who can navigate complexity while fostering innovation, trust, and collaboration. From economic instability and climate crises to technological disruption and societal inequality, the world’s challenges require leadership that transcends transactional management.


Why the world needs transformational leaders


1. To address global challenges with vision


Transformational leaders understand the power of a clear and compelling vision. They don’t just react to problems, they proactively envision solutions that inspire collective action. As Crown Prince Mohammed bin Salman of Saudi Arabia demonstrated with Vision 2030, a strong vision has the power to mobilize people, align resources, and bring about systemic change.


2. To unite diverse perspectives


In a globally connected yet divided world, leaders must act as unifiers. They must foster inclusivity and respect for diversity, bridging gaps across cultures, industries, and ideologies. As Ratan Tata once said, “Leadership is about uniting people and inspiring them to achieve a common goal.” Such leadership turns differences into strengths.


3. To empower innovation and creativity


The future demands creativity to solve problems that haven’t even been identified yet. Great leaders cultivate environments where teams feel empowered to innovate, take risks, and push boundaries. Companies like Google and L’Oréal thrive because of leaders who prioritize creativity and encourage their teams to think beyond the ordinary.


4. To build trust in institutions


Trust in institutions, governments, corporations, and organizations, has been waning. Restoring this trust requires empathetic, transparent leadership. People gravitate toward leaders who act with integrity, communicate openly, and align actions with values. As Gary Vaynerchuk reminds us, “The best leaders are not scared to show vulnerability. They are real, and people connect with that.”


The new definition of leadership


Leadership in the modern world is no longer about control; it’s about empowerment. The most effective leaders inspire ownership, accountability, and a sense of shared purpose among their teams. They don’t micromanage, but instead guide, support, and challenge individuals to reach their full potential.


Empathy is a critical component of this new leadership paradigm. Leaders who prioritize the well-being and development of their teams cultivate loyalty, creativity, and resilience. They build organizations that are not only successful but also humane, ensuring long-term sustainability and impact.


Lessons from business and politics


  • Emaar Properties in Dubai is a testament to how visionary leadership can transform a local company into a global powerhouse. By setting ambitious goals and empowering teams to execute them, Emaar reshaped Dubai’s skyline and global reputation.

  • Sanofi, a pharmaceutical leader, showcases how a commitment to innovation and patient-centric approaches can revolutionize healthcare, impacting millions of lives worldwide.

  • Political figures like Sheikh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um exemplify the power of leadership grounded in vision and action. His philosophy of building trust and fostering progress has inspired a generation to dream big and achieve bigger.


Moving toward a better tomorrow


As the world stands at a crossroads, the demand for leaders who can navigate these turbulent times with courage, vision, and empathy has never been greater. Leadership today isn’t about wielding authority; it’s about inspiring collaboration, fostering innovation, and creating a shared path toward a better future.


This new generation of leaders has the potential to redefine what is possible, turning today’s challenges into tomorrow’s opportunities. The world isn’t just looking for leaders, it’s looking for changemakers, visionaries, and humanitarians who can inspire hope and guide us toward a brighter, more inclusive future.
